The Fundamentals of Blockchain



Blockchain innovation, an innovative idea in digital information administration, fundamentally changes exactly how info is stored and secured. At its core, a blockchain is a dispersed ledger that records purchases throughout a network of computer systems, making sure openness and immutability. The innovation operates a chain of blocks, each having a list of purchases. As soon as a block is loaded, it is time-stamped and connected to the previous block, creating a sequential chain.


Secret to understanding blockchain is the hashing procedure, which secures transaction data right into an unique alphanumeric code. This cryptographic function guarantees that any change in the transaction data results in a completely various hash, thereby securing against meddling. The agreement system, an additional essential part, validates and validates new transactions through a network of nodes, therefore eliminating the demand for a central authority.


Moreover, blockchain's append-only structure guarantees that information, as soon as included, can not be deleted or modified. This characteristic warranties a irreversible and verifiable record of transactions, cultivating count on among participants. Therefore, blockchain provides a robust framework for information stability, using industries a reliable technique for monitoring and managing electronic info in a secure, transparent manner.


Decentralization and Protection



Decentralization, a core principle of blockchain innovation, considerably boosts information security by dispersing control throughout a network instead than depending on a single, central entity. By distributing data throughout countless nodes, blockchain ensures that even if one node is compromised, the entire network continues to be safe and secure.

In decentralized systems, consensus systems like Proof of Work or Proof of Risk are employed to verify purchases, ensuring that harmful actors can not easily manipulate the information. These devices require most of nodes to settle on the legitimacy of a purchase prior to it is added to the blockchain, thus protecting against illegal tasks.


In addition, decentralization encourages customers with better control over their information. Each participant in the network has accessibility to the whole blockchain, enabling them to validate and investigate deals independently. This transparency promotes count on among customers, as they do not need to count on a central authority to make sure information integrity. Generally, decentralization contributes in improving information protection in blockchain networks.

Cryptographic Strategies



At the heart of blockchain modern technology, cryptographic methods play an essential role in safeguarding information, making certain both discretion and stability. Cryptography in blockchain employs a combination of asymmetric and symmetrical formulas to encrypt data, making it easily accessible only to licensed celebrations.

In addition, electronic signatures verify the credibility and stability of transactions, supplying a layer of non-repudiation.


The decentralized nature of blockchain, incorporated with robust cryptographic techniques, eliminates the need for intermediaries, minimizing potential vulnerabilities. As blockchain innovation develops, innovations in cryptography such as zero-knowledge proofs and homomorphic file encryption continue to enhance security steps, even more fortifying data protection in this innovative digital journal system.
